I will never forget this game-changing piece of malleable advice that my father told me when I was stuck in a rut: “I remember the first time I saw a universal remote control. I thought to myself: ‘Well, this changes everything.’”

It is time to meet your universal ‘flirting’ remote: dad jokes. Implementing off-the-wall humor when flirting could be the change you need. Typically, corny and predictable puns bring out the inner dad in every would-be wooer.

Dad jokes give off the impression that making the other person laugh, no matter how cheesy, is more important than throwing an uncomfortable compliment at them. Humor of this nature utilizes a PG-friendly way to begin conversations. The best thing about cheesy dad quips is its ability to break the ice (insert corny Titanic joke here).

Cheesy dad puns also put a little spice on the same old mundane conversations. They work because they show you are putting in the effort to be bold and different.

Let’s face it, everyone is not Donald Glover spewing wit better than he can fly the Millennium Falcon. Your super stardom strikes when you land the best dad joke of the millennia. There is something sexy about witticisms that can make even Luke’s dad laugh.

Dad Jokes To Level Up Your Dating Game

  1. Where are you from? I love my neighborhood and I’d like to give a shout out to all the sidewalks for keeping me off the streets.

One way to begin a conversation is with a greeting (such as hello or how are you) before instituting a dad joke because it often comes off off smoother. One-liners are simple to employ and anyone can use this type of banter even if you believe you are missing the funny bone. Introductory puns are the easiest way to lighten the mood upon the first encounter.

4. My grandpa has the heart of a lion and a lifetime ban from the zoo.

Discussing families is always a good start when getting to know someone because they influence a person the most, whether that is good or bad. The best way to use dad jokes of this stature is to use important members of your own family because it eases into more relative family conversations. If you do not have a sister, do not use a sister related quip.

5. What did the cell say to his sister when she stepped on his foot? Mitosis

For anyone that grew up in the 90’s “Mitosis is” is a running joke from the first season of the hit television show “Sabrina the Teenage Witch,” so all these cell division antics crack me up and make me very nostalgic. Harvey Kinkle first asked Sabrina Spellman what mitosis was during a study date 22 years ago and I still giggle at it. Using pop culture and hit shows, past or present, in your innuendos is a good way to connect to your crush.

8. Why was Cinderella thrown off the basketball team? She ran away from the ball.

Sporty puns transitions to inquiring about someone’s love of sports without the unamusing question, ‘hey, do you like sports?’ This is a very adaptable pun as well, you can use any ball based sport to relate it back to your interests. If you like soccer then ask the person you admire why the shoeless princess was kicked off the soccer team, or insert your favorite team.

9. Where does Fonzie go for lunch? Chick-Fil-Ayyyye.

Food is always the safest pun out there. Want to know why? Because everyone eats. It is human nature to indulge in meals. This lends to learning if your crush has any special diets or allergens. Also, this is an excellent segway to asking a person out on a date to get, you know, food.
